Output 8a3a51fc187da649f29a175a3cc054633926b6d0490251fcd425c6e800037d37:8

value
2171892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e70ff35c879623b42c47685ee65bb54e43ac37 OP_EQUAL
address
3AypyQgjp7ktuoRuswnpvTQTHvDNPCPiL9
transaction
8a3a51fc187da649f29a175a3cc054633926b6d0490251fcd425c6e800037d37
confirmations
223013
spent
true